Quito presenta en su estructura una trama yuxtapuesta de realidades sincrónicas: la ciudad quimérica con pedazos del ayer y hoy que se entremezclan y persisten en vestigios que reflejan el poder constructivo de la urbe; la ciudad transhumante, cuya vocación representativa e integradora recupera la identidad colectiva, a partir de relatos y memorias, y la ciudad real donde se articula el imaginario colectivo sobre el acontecer local y nacional. A partir de determinadas coyunturas políticas de la última década, el estudio propone una reflexión sobre la ciudad de Quito tomando como referencia tres lugares: la Tribuna de los Shyris, la Plaza de Santo Domingo y la Tribuna del Sur. Desde esta muestra, el estudio identifica espacios de reapropiación y resignificación que permiten tender puentes y crear redes de articulación entre el norte, centro y sur de la urbe. Los espacios que antes eran el marco escenográfico donde la sociedad se desenvolvía, como parte de su cotidianidad, ahora son retomados como elementos centrales para superar la realidad física en la proyección de la identidad.

Este libro indaga sobre tres niveles discursivos que se interrelacionan entre sí: la ciudad quimérica (la ciudad de los recuerdos), la ciudad trashumante (el lenguaje de los usos citadinos contemporáneos) y la ciudad real (el lenguaje de la política y de la participación ciudadana) en tres espacios: la Tribuna de los Shyris, la Plaza de Santo Domingo y la Tribuna del Sur. El primer capítulo, «Ciudad quimérica», explora los distintos cambios históricos, demográficos, sociales y políticos de los tres espacios que representan el norte, centro y sur de la urbe, cuyos contrastes y diferencias están determinados por sus luchas históricas. El capítulo 2, «Ciudad trashumante», se detiene en las dinámicas sociales y culturales con el análisis de las prácticas de los actores urbanos y sus distintas maneras de ocupación y representación. El capítulo 3, «Ciudad real», describe los diversos actos de participación social y protestas populares que en la década 1997-2007 terminaron con el derrocamiento de tres gobiernos: Quito como espacio de la protesta y sitio estratégico para mirar lo nacional. Esta investigación muestra que, a través de estas prácticas políticas, los habitantes trascienden los esquemas urbanos, tienden puentes y diseñan estrategias colectivas que convierten los espacios públicos en lugares de circulación social, donde se generan dinámicas de significación espacial (lugares) y formas de participación e interacción social.

A finales del siglo XX, se asiste a una nueva etapa del desarrollo de la estética urbana, marcada por la aplicación y presencia de las nuevas tecnologías y la aparición de nuevos agentes sociales como el escritor de grafiti, el artista de la calle o el activista contracultural. El grafiti, entendido como práctica cultural tradicionalmente urbana, se encuentra sujeto a las transformaciones que manifiestan la sociedad y el espacio de la ciudad, adaptándose continuamente y desde diferentes formatos a la realidad social. En esta práctica se observa un modo de reafirmar identidades, criticar y proponer proyectos de ciudad posibles. Además, las intervenciones de calle producidas por escritores de grafiti, artistas urbanos o activistas culturales, sociales y políticos contribuyen a la construcción y definición de la imagen pública de una determinada área urbana, subrayando o alterando la imagen tradicional de dichos espacios. En esa línea de ideas, la investigación analizará el graffiti en los aspectos correspondientes a los actores que ejecutan las intervenciones, el contexto político y coyuntural en el que nacen estas iniciativas, el contenido visual y lingüístico de los mismos, así como el espacio geográfico en el que se plasman, entendiendo que cada uno de ellos brinda una espesor interpretativo que enriquece el trabajo desarrollado. Por lo tanto, el estudio del grafiti en la ciudad de Quito es relevante en cuanto permite evaluar, en términos cualitativos: la vitalidad ciudadana del área metropolitana, la pluralidad de sus agentes culturales, sus pretensiones, su carácter crítico, su nivel de pensamiento y formación, el grado de conciencia y participación en la transformación social.

This article is a case study of the emergence of the intellectual in Spanish American: the trajectory of Alfonso Reyes. In Latin America modernity and the beginnings of the 20th Century contributed to circumstances and historical processes that permitted the 19th Century literates to progressively transform into intellectual: to be exact a ‘transitional intellectual’. This study looks at some of the dynamics that validated the intellectual as a new social actor during the period studied. The public visibility as it was never before, placed thinkers, and the use of means of communication of the time and the cultural elements like books and magazines, allowing that they be turned into public figures and to obtain some of their objectives.

Essa dissertação analisa o potencial de medidas de gerenciamento da demanda no transporte coletivo por ônibus urbano, com foco na tarifa diferenciada por hora do dia. A simultaneidade temporal e espacial das atividades determina picos de demanda por transportes em certos horários do dia, causando congestionamento nas vias e sobrecarga nos transportes coletivos. Neste contexto, o transporte coletivo desempenha importante papel, uma vez que se constitui como único meio de transporte para grande parte da população, além de ser a alternativa mais sustentável para as viagens motorizadas. A conveniência de uma distribuição mais uniforme da demanda por viagens decorre das perdas provocadas pelo congestionamento e do desperdício de recursos que representa a capacidade ociosa do transporte coletivo e do sistema viário urbano nos horários de baixa demanda. Políticas de gerenciamento da demanda por transportes visando diluir os picos são aplicadas com fteqüência em grandes centros urbanos e, entre as medidas que atuam diretamente sobre a demanda por transporte coletivo, destacam-se as políticas tarifárias, programas de horário de trabalho flexível, escalonado, com semana comprimida ou teletrabalho, e, também, melhorias dos níveis de serviço. Tarifa diferenciada por hora do dia no transporte público é prática corrente em diversos países. Com o objetivo de influenciar o usuário quanto à escolha do horário de viagem, adotam-se valores tarifários mais altos para as viagens realizadas nos períodos de pico e mais baixos fora do pico Essa estratégia busca atrair a demanda mais elástica para os horários em que o sistema é menos solicitado. A justificativa para a discriminação apóia-se no fato de que a excessiva concentração de usuários em poucas horas do dia é um dos fatores responsáveis pela elevação dos custos totais do sistema. O estudo de caso permitiu analisar, através de modelagem comportamental, a resposta da demanda do período de pico a políticas de diferenciação tarifária por hora do dia. A metodologia empregada mostrou-se adequada e os resultados encontrados permitem concluir que políticas que contemplem variações tarifárias em troca de alterações nos horários de início da viagem podem ser empregadas no contexto analisado. Ainda, verificou-se que os entrevistados aos quais é proposta a antecipação do horário de viagem são mais elásticos do que aqueles aos quais é proposta a postergação do horário de viagem.

If urban planning is to support the equitable distribution of public goods and services, it must recognize and address the dismal condition of millions of poor people who are living in a city. The primary focus of contemporary planners and planning students should be on finding and advocating solutions that help eliminate the problems of today¿s cities. Any meaningful solution will need to be grounded in a thorough understanding of the social class inequities of citizens. With the rapid development of national economy and urbanization process in Brazil over the last two decades, the number of vehicles and their travels are dramatically increased. This is particularly evident in all large cities. Traffic congestion becomes more and more severe. Inadequate parking facilities often result in difficulty to find a parking space in large cities and many illegally parked vehicles can be seen on the crowed streets. These illegally parked vehicles further intensify traffic congestion and also pose a traffic safety hazard. The process of urbanization and motorization in Brazil is likely to continue in a rapid pace. The urban public passengers transport modes problems in large cities are likely to get even worse. There is an urgent need for the development of policy and criteria for public service of urban public passenger transport by bus in large cities. The purpose of survey is to develop policy guidelines for public transport services planning, design, construction and mobility management, that meet community needs for accessibility in large cities. So this thesis will present major comparative characteristics of urban mobility management, urban public passengers transport by bus services planning and the quality of social life in two towns of Brazil: Rio de Janeiro and Curitiba. The study case has been focused on Rio de Janeiro and Curitiba because of the major different results of the survey presented by the two cities. The objectives of this thesis are: a) to analyze and discus existing urban mobility related accessibility and economic development problems in large cities; b) to provide an overview of the relationship within city ¿ quality of social life ¿ urban mobility in Rio and Curitiba; c) to analyze and discuss existing urban mobility management related public transport services in Rio and Curitiba; d) to analyze and discuss existing quality of bus public transport services problems in Rio. Some preliminary recommendations for mobility management policies will also be presented.

The use of Natural Gas Vehicle has had a fast increase lately. However, in order to have a continuous success this Program needs to develop converting devices of Otto-cycle engines, gasoline or alcohol, to the use of NGV (Natural Gas Vehicle) that presents low cost, maintaining the same original development of the vehicle and low level of emissions, considering the PROCONVE rules. Due to the need to diversify the matrix in order to avoid energetic dependence and due to strict pollution control, it has increased in the Brazilian market the number of vehicles converted to the use of NGV. The recent regulation of the PROCONVE, determining that the converted engines with kits should be submitted to emission testing, comes to reinforce the necessity of the proposed development. Therefore, if we can obtain kits with the characteristics already described, we can reach a major trust in the market and obtain an increase acceptance of the vehicle conversion for NGV. The use of natural gas as vehicle fuel presents several advantages in relation to liquid fuels. It is a vehicle fuel with fewer indexes of emissions when compared to diesel; their combustion gases are less harmful, with a major level of safety than liquid fuels and the market price is quite competitive. The preoccupation that emerges, and the motivation of this project, is to know which are the main justifications for such technology, well accepted in other countries, with a low index or emission, with a high level of safety, where its maintenance becomes low, reminding that for this it is necessary that this technology has to be used properly, and once available in the market will not motivate interest in the urban transportation companies in Brazil, in research centers in general. Therefore this project exists to show the society in a general way the current vision of the main governmental factors, of the national research centers and of the private companies concerning the use of natural gas vehicles in urban transport vehicles, in order to give a major reliability to the population as well as to motivate national market competitiveness with a low cost and reliable product and to enrich the national technology

This thesis carries through an application of Analysis of Multicriterion Decision with use of the method of Analytical Hierarchy Process (AHP) in the problematic one of taking of decision of the adoption of electronic collecting in the system of urban transport in the country, a subject that has been controversial. A modeling of criteria and alternatives is carried through and applied a questionnaire based on method AHP the excellent actors in the system of urban transport - Leading of the Managing Agency Public Municipal theatre of Urban Transports, Controller of Company of Bus, Controller of Labor union, Controller of Union of Companies, Communitarian Leader. The considered alternatives were: the maintenance of the current state with collectors, the implementation of electronic collection without collectors, and the implementation of electronic collection with collectors. The used criteria were: job, impact in the fare, control of the system, easiness of use, information. The study was carried through in the city of Natal, RN, where if the adoption of electronic collection argues and where this implementation in some bus lines between Natal and Parnamirim exists, city that integrates the region of the great Natal. The main results of the method evidence in a dimension, the viability of use of method AHP with questionnaire by means of validation of the judgments with analysis of variance beyond proper the normal mechanisms of analysis of consistency to the method, and in another one, the contribution of the analysis boarding multicriterion to become the judgments more clearly. The main results of the analysis help to show that although to models of criteria and distinct judgments of the actors, the method evidenced that it has inclination the adoption of the electronic collection on the current situation, even so with divergences between the maintenance or not of the collector. The research points to the possibility of accomplishment of the application of the AHP in successive rounds of judgments
